Smithland Up After Back to Back Hands

Level 16 : Blinds 4,000/8,000, 8,000 ante

Action began preflop with a raise of 17,000 from the early position player. Both Kurt Smithland on the button, and the big blind player made the call. The board ran out 10Q7, as big blind checked to the raiser. The initial raiser led out for 20,000, having Smithland jam all in for 175,000. Both players folded with Smithland taking the pot.

Fresh off his previous win, it folded around to Smithland in the cutoff. He raised to 16,000 quickly facing a three bet from the Gabe Ramos in the big blind for 65,000. Smithland resigned folding his hand as Ramos scooped this pot.

Kothari Eliminates Balfour After Two Tries

Level 16 : Blinds 4,000/8,000, 8,000 ante

Preflop action folded to Dhruvin Kothari in late position who raised to 16,000. Sean Balfour then went all in for 59,000 from the hijack. Kothari called.

Sean Balfour: KK
Dhruvin Kothari: 35

The flop was 2Q10, keeping Balfour well in the lead. The 4 came on the turn, giving Kothari a straight draw.

"Wait wait wait!" yelled Balfour to the dealer. The river came 5, doubling up Balfour.

On the very next hand, Balfour faced a raise to 16,000 from a player in middle position and a call from Korthari. Balfour went all in for 135,000, and Kothari called.

Sean Balfour: AK
Dhruvin Kothari: 88

The flop came 9J7. Balfour paired up when the A hit on the turn, but the 8 river gave Kothari the win and sent Balfour out.

Day 1d Payouts Confirmed

Level 17 : Blinds 5,000/10,000, 10,000 ante

Day 1d attracted a total of 8,061 entries, confirming the total number of entries for the tournament at a staggering 18,194. Although the exact breakdown of payouts for the combined field has not yet been confirmed, the tournament directors have announced that 1,210 players from today will be in the money, each of whom will secure at least $1,061.

Famous Last Words "I'm Only Shoving Aces or Kings"

Level 17 : 5,000/10,000, 10,000 ante
Michael Bohmerwald
Michael Bohmerwald

With just 4 players left before the bubble bursts the action folded to a player in middle position who says "I'm only shoving aces or kings" before moving all in for his remaining 77,000 chips. Michael Bohmerwald is the very next player to act and calmly slides in some chips to signify a call. The remaining players fold and the cards are on their back.

Middle Position: KK
Michael Bohmerwald: AA

The board ran out queen high and Bohmerwald deals the brutal cooler to eliminate his opponent just minutes before the money.

Two Barrels Good For Moraes

Level 17 : Blinds 5,000/10,000, 10,000 ante

Rafael Moraes opened to 23,000 from middle position and was called by the big blind.

Action checked to Moraes on a flop of A68 and he continued for 16,000. His opponent made the call to see a turn.

The turn came K prompting the big blind to check for a second time. Moraes showed no signs of slowing down, instead making it a hefty 45,000 to go. That second bet was enough to get the fold and send a decent pot the Brazilian pro's way.
